NY Public Library Reading Program is offered in every library branch in the city. This program provides free activies to children including Story Time for babies, toddlers, and preschoolers as well as film screenings, arts & crafts, chess, and a summer reading celebration program to encourage literacy.

Email this post The Metropolitan Opera offers free summer events in parks of NYC and New Jersey.
This year, the company will present a six-performance series of recitals in the parks of all five boroughs for the Summer Recital Series. Performances include Tony Award winner Paulo Szot and opera singers Lisette Oropesa and Alek Shrader with accompaniment by pianist Vlad Iftinca. Actor/conductor Damon Gupton will host several of the concerts. All performances are free and no tickets are required, except for the concert at SummerStage. For information on how to obtain free SummerStage tickets, please visit their website beginning June 1.
Starting August 29, the Met will present its first-ever Summer HD Festival, featuring screenings of ten productions from the company’s Peabody and Emmy Award-winning Live in HD series. The HD productions will be shown in Lincoln Center Plaza on consecutive nights—for free. Start times will range from 7:30pm to 8:00pm. The screenings are free with no tickets required; 2800 seats will be available each night on a first-come, first served basis. There are no rain dates.

River Flicks shows free popular films and includes free popcorn!
Pier 54 on Wednesdays shows movies for “grown-ups” which are generally rated PG-13 and R. These movies are your favorite blockbusters from 2008!
Pier 46 on Fridays shows family-oriented films which are generally rated G or PG. These movies are new and classic films for the whole family!
